Currently, command “iw wlan0 station dump” does not show per-chain signal strength. This is because ath12k does not handle the num_per_chain_rssi and rssi_avg_beacon reported by firmware to ath12k. To address this, update ath12k to send WMI_REQUEST_STATS_CMDID with the flag WMI_REQUEST_RSSI_PER_CHAIN_STAT to the firmware. Then, add logic to handle num_per_chain_rssi and rssi_avg_beacon in the ath12k_wmi_tlv_fw_stats_parse(), and assign the resulting per-chain signal strength to the chain_signal of struct station_info. After that, "iw dev xxx station dump" shows the correct per-chain signal strength.
